Output c306427e0229690e78bc6991f0542da2e62d0540a8227db767a9f2ec51c63150:3

value
277031426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37bd2f13e708de9ea8d4c7f624ebc2df3f0867be OP_EQUAL
address
MCyt2i3e3bQHbJgL1aV7XmjcPkPXxFFNnm
transaction
c306427e0229690e78bc6991f0542da2e62d0540a8227db767a9f2ec51c63150
spent
true